WebJun 26, 2015 · They are the most severe ligament injuries to the ankle and occur either in isolation or at the same time as an ankle fracture. Typical fractures associated with syndesmotic instability include pronation external rotation fractures (PER or Weber type C), supination external rotation fractures (SER or Weber type B), and proximal fibular … WebBengnér, Epidemiology of ankle fracture 1950 and 1980: increasing incidence in elderly women, Acta Orthop Scand, № 57, с. 35 ...
